Engage in outside business development, market ATI services, and build client relationships. | Minimum two years' experience in marketing and sales, with proven success in business development, and familiarity with CRM systems like Salesforce. | Job Summary The Business Development Managers (BDM) primary function is engaging in outside business development, which requires the BDM to spend more than half of their working time away from the office presenting ATI services. BDM will market ATI's services to the various clients to include but are not limited to: Facility Managers, Risk Managers, Independent Adjusters, Insurance Carriers, Insurance Brokers and Insurance Agents. TOP PAY & BENEFITS PROVIDED Responsibilities * Generates approximately $2+ million annually in multiple ATI markets (Specific yearly sales goals will vary from individual to individual). * Develops, maintains, implements, and revises as necessary an individual marketing plan. * Generates at least 100 leads * Generates projects for at least two (2) different branches on an annual * Establishes Regional Accounts with adjusters, general adjusters, risk managers, facilities managers, property managers, end users, contractors, and/or insurance * Handles promotion of all ATI nationwide branch * Assists during local, regional and national marketing blitzes, when called * Supports ATI in Catastrophic situations, when called * Attends promotion of assigned nationally sponsored events, including trade-shows, golf tournaments, social events, luncheons, and any other assigned ATI marketing functions. * Trains new Account * Documents field work and activity thru SalesForce.com. * This position will require overnight travel of at least 10% of the time * Other assigned projects or work * Market environmental and abatement services to NE firms Essential Functions * Creates and updates a marketing plan to include target accounts/contacts. * Identifies opportunities, plans, executes and measures results, including the tracking of leads. * Actively markets to new potential ATI clients/relationships. * Maintains and builds existing customer relationships. * Develops and manages strategies needed to address business development issues critical to penetrating new markets as well as maintaining ATI's position as a leader in key markets. * Develops new business and seeks new prospects within market scope. * Manages (prospective) customer activities related to development programs and demonstrates a strong business sense in approaching complex issues. * Coordinates delivery of customer service. * Performs follow up with existing accounts and/or active production. * Sells and networks at trade-show events and conferences. * Maintains a high level of customer service. * Develops marketing campaigns to generate traffic throughout the portfolio while working within set budgets. * Documents lead generation, activity, sales tracking and analysis thru CRM system * Performs competitive market analysis. * Administers marketing program/campaign development, execution, management and analysis * Coordinates and manages all activities related to trade-show/conference activity alignment of projects and daily activities with the Director of Business Development and Regional Leadership. * Other duties as assigned. Required Experience * Minimum two (2) years' experience in marketing and sales. * Proven record of accomplishment of successful sales and business development in the service industry. * Ability to structure and negotiate strategic alliances within the region. * Execution of targeted marketing programs and market development strategies * Salesforce or other CRM database experience desired but not necessary * Ability to seek out and develop marketing opportunities * Ability to develop regional commercialization strategies * Excellent presentation skills * Open-mindedness and creativity * Excellent time management skills * Must be able to work effectively and efficiently in a dynamic, fast moving, deadline driven environment.

Oversee multiple construction projects, coordinate with clients and subcontractors, manage budgets and schedules, ensure safety and compliance. | High school diploma or equivalent, minimum three years of construction superintendent experience, relevant certifications, physical ability to perform job duties. | JOB SUMMARY The Project Manager, working in conjunction with the Project Director (PD), will simultaneously oversee multiple residential, commercial, industrial and institutional projects. The Project Manager will report at least three times a week on the status of the job to the PD. Project Managers will work closely with PDs on managing project payment terms and collection of all outstanding amounts. PRINCIPAL RESPONSIBILITIES Job duties (Including, but not limited to): * Manages high risk, high exposure and/or complex * Communicates professionally with customers, subcontractors and insurance * Provides technical explanations to clients, adjusters, consultants and * Coordinates job starts and schedule appointments with customers, and * Executes Project Director directions/instructions regarding project payment terms and collection of outstanding account receivable (A/R) * Requests payment from customers upon substantial completion of work and when getting COS signed in accordance with established payment terms. * Alerts Project Director regarding next stage of payment in accordance with established payment * Complements Project Director's efforts regarding collecting project outstanding A/R * Coordinates work duties with subcontractors and field personnel. * Provides constructive feedback and direction to complete tasks on time and within budget. * Coordinates after-hours emergency services, including board-ups, water damage, fire and smoke damage and * Obtains all city permits and inspections and/or certified * Observes all OSHA, EPA, SCAQMD * Ensures compliance with all applicable safety * Assures compliance with DOT * Manages multiple projects simultaneously over a multi-location region. * Uses Salesforce to manage projects, run reports, input and manage work orders, and forecasting budgets/labor/material. * Other related duties as assigned   Technical Skills: Must be proficient in MS Office, Xactimate, Salesforce.com, and structural building experience. Insurance restoration experience is a plus.   Communication Skills: Fluent English, both oral and written. Strong technical writing skills and ability to effectively express his or herself orally in project reviews conducted among internal staff, before groups of customers or employees of the organization. Work Environment: Working primarily in an administrative environment, will frequently visit sites with a work environment that is usually dirty, dusty and noisy, on uneven ground/surfaces containing hazardous or potentially hazardous substances and/or materials and is subject to inclement or extreme weather conditions and temperatures.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.   Physical Demands: Must be in good physical health and be able to meet the medical clearance requirements of an OSHA (HAZWOPER) medical surveillance physical examination and drug screening. Able to wear full and half face respirator and lift/carry 50 pounds.   Travel Requirements: This position will require some travel at various times and must be willing to work odd- hours, weekends and holidays as called upon.   REQUIRED E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E: * High School diploma or equivalent, some college is a plus * Minimum of three years of Superintendent experience in all phases of construction * A combination of commercial and residential experience is preferred   Certifications Needed: The candidate will be in possession of a current asbestos, lead, and mold certifications. Will also have llCRC AMRT certification. Such certification shall be issued by a Certified State training provider as identified by OSHA The individual must have on file a valid and current environmental physical enabling the individual to wear a respirator. Also, OSHA 30 hr. construction course, current State Driver's license and forklift operator certification.   Additional Eligibility Qualifications: The successful candidate will have a positive attitude, strong work ethic with the ability to follow directions. Experience operating vehicles up to 26,000 GVW and operating truck-trailer combinations. Good communication skills and commitment to company safety policy are a must. Must be legally eligible to work in the United States. Bilingual English/Spanish is encouraged, but not required.
